Subject: [PATCH v2] rt-tests: cyclictest: Suppress compiler warnings for unused variables
Date: Mon, 14 Aug 2023 14:01:57 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20230814120157.34783-1-ezulian@redhat.com> (raw)
Using an attribute to inform the compiler that variables are expect to
be unused so it will not issue a warning.

diff --git a/src/cyclictest/cyclictest.c b/src/cyclictest/cyclictest.c
index 4a7108e..a28057c 100644
--- a/src/cyclictest/cyclictest.c
+++ b/src/cyclictest/cyclictest.c
@@ -1614,7 +1614,7 @@ static void rstat_print_stat(struct thread_param *par, int index, int verbose, i
* thread that creates a named fifo and hands out run stats when someone
* reads from the fifo.
*/
-static void *fifothread(void *param)
+static void *fifothread(__attribute__((__unused__)) void *param)
{
int ret;
int fd;
@@ -1795,7 +1795,7 @@ rstat_err:
return;
}
-static void write_stats(FILE *f, void *data)
+static void write_stats(FILE *f, __attribute__((__unused__)) void *data)
{
struct thread_param **par = parameters;
unsigned int i, j, comma;
